CVE-2019-6485: Medium severity netscaler gateway vulnerability
Citrix NetScaler Gateway 12.1 before build 50.31, 12.0 before build 60.9, 11.1 before build 60.14, 11.0 before build 72.17, and 10.5 before build 69.5 and Application Delivery Controller (ADC) 12.1 before build 50.31, 12.0 before build 60.9, 11.1 before build 60.14, 11.0 before build 72.17, and 10.5 before build 69.5 allow remote attackers to obtain sensitive plaintext information because of a TLS Padding Oracle Vulnerability when CBC-based cipher suites are enabled.

What is the severity of CVE-2019-6485?
The severity of CVE-2019-6485 is medium with a severity value of 5.9.
Which software versions are affected by CVE-2019-6485?
Citrix NetScaler Gateway Firmware versions 10.5, 11.0, 11.1, 12.0, and 12.1, as well as Citrix NetScaler Application Delivery Controller Firmware versions 10.5, 11.0, 11.1, 12.0, and 12.1 are affected by CVE-2019-6485.
How can I fix CVE-2019-6485?
To fix CVE-2019-6485, update your Citrix NetScaler Gateway and Citrix NetScaler Application Delivery Controller firmware to the recommended versions provided by Citrix.
